What is the Mid-Market Operational Transparency course about?
Mid-market organizations face unique challenges: too complex for startup-style informality, too agile for legacy enterprise controls. Without structured transparency, hybrid teams experience misalignment, duplicated efforts, and delayed outcomes , even when individuals are productive.

Who is the Mid-Market Operational Transparency course for?
Business operations leads, IT governance specialists, and technology managers in mid-market firms (100, 2,000 employees) who own or influence operational workflows across distributed teams.
Who is the Mid-Market Operational Transparency course not for?
Enterprise executives managing 10,000+ person organizations, freelance solopreneurs, or technical specialists focused only on tool configuration without cross-functional process design.
